Air Filter Maintenance
Operating conditions determine frequency of service.
Is the 'CHANGE AIR FILTER' message displayed?
If the 'CHANGE AIR FILTER' message is displayed, air filter requires servicing or changing.
HEAVY-DUTY AIR FILTER (Figure 6-1) furnished as standard equipment on units with an enclosure is a heavy-duty washable element dry type air filter.
The air filter must receive proper maintenance if maximum service is to be obtained from the unit.
Establishing adequate and timely filter service is MOST IMPORTANT.
Is the air filter properly maintained?
An improperly maintained air filter can cause a loss of compressor air delivery.

100 Hourly Filter Element Service
Filter Element – The element should be serviced when inspection indicates an accumulation of dirt on the outside of the element. Clean every 100 to 500 operating hours depending on dust conditions. Inspect every few days until experience determines the proper time interval for servicing.
To Service:
1. Remove the element from the filter housing.
2. Blow off excess dirt with air nozzle. Direct air blast parallel to element pleats at a slight upward angle. Do not point air blast directly at the element.
3. Elements contaminated with dry dirt only:
(a) Mix a sufficient amount of warm water and household detergent to allow the element to be fully submerged.
(b) Place the element into the cleaning solution and allow to soak for five minutes. Agitate in solution for two more minutes. Elements contaminated with oil or greasy dirt deposits:
(a) Mix a sufficient amount of the following cleaning solution to allow the element to be fully submerged. To one gallon of lukewarm water add four tablespoons of mild house hold detergent and one–half teaspoon of trisodium phosphate. Mix well.
(b) Place element into cleaning solution and allow to soak for five minutes. Agitate in solution and allow to soak for five minutes. Agitate in solution for two minutes and remove.
Standard Filter Element Life Maintenance
WARNING: Do not oil this element. Do not wash in other cleaning fluids. Never operate unit without element. Never use elements that are damaged or ruptured. Never use elements that won’t seal. Keep spare elements on hand to reduce downtime.
